You Have A Room In My Heart Poem by Robert Hiers

You Have A Room In My Heart

Rating: 5.0


You have a room in my heart
A room without walls
A room with sky all around

The breeze blows freely through it
Carrying each passing moment
On gentle gusts of memory

No end is in sight
No hint of a beginning remains
The room was always there, waiting
